Latest Patents

Among his latest innovations is a facsimile transceiver. Additionally, he has developed a projector that utilizes guest-host liquid crystal cells to improve color purity. This projector features a unique arrangement of polarizers and liquid crystal cells aligned along the light axis. The design includes a first color polarizer colored in red, followed by a series of twisted nematic liquid crystal cells and additional color polarizers. This innovative approach allows for the replacement of inferior color characteristic polarizers with guest-host type liquid crystal cells, resulting in improved excitation purity and a broader color reproduction range. Furthermore, the additive mixture of colors enhances the brightness of the reproduced images.
